Top EV Charger Firms and Their Innovations

The electric vehicle powering industry is rapidly developing, fueled by substantial investment and constant development . Several leading manufacturers are driving this transformation . Tesla, known for its Supercharger infrastructure, continues to enhance its platform and consider new power management techniques . ABB is showcasing leadership with its range of fast DC stations, centered on commercial implementations. Wallbox is building waves with its intuitive personal charging solutions and new two-way charging features . Finally, ChargePoint is establishing a vast infrastructure and combining digital platforms to streamline the charging experience for drivers . Each firm is adding to the expanding ecosystem of EV vehicle power options .

Boosting EV Adoption: A Look at Charger Infrastructure

The growth of electric vehicle (EV) acceptance is intrinsically dependent on the availability of a robust charging network. Currently, a significant barrier to broader EV purchase is range anxiety and the limited public charging points. Building out this necessary infrastructure requires substantial capital from both public sectors. Programs are underway to boost charger deployment, including grants for organizations and residents. A variety of charging solutions – slow charging, standard charging, and rapid charging – is needed to meet the varying demands of EV users. In conclusion, a thoughtful and fair charging system is crucial for fulfilling the full potential of electric mobility.

Electric Vehicle Charger Manufacturing: Developments and Difficulties

The quick expansion of electric vehicles is driving unprecedented need for EV charging station manufacturing. Current trends show a shift towards higher-power load systems, including DC fast powering technologies, and increased use of bidirectional loads capabilities. However, the sector faces several significant challenges. These include raw material shortages , particularly for critical battery components and chips , as well as rising manufacturing expenditures and the need for qualified labor. Moreover , consistency of power protocols and compatibility across different systems remain a persistent concern, hindering wider deployment and user usage . Finally, supply chain resilience and geographic manufacturing options are becoming increasingly important to mitigate risks and ensure a consistent supply of charging stations .
